Luxury today means spacious kitchens, sleek master bathrooms, and lots of flexibility baked into the design. What it doesn’t have to mean: a big lot. These home plans from Florida-based designer Dan Sater showcase upscale amenities without requiring a ton of land.

Flexes to an Upscale Empty Nest

This elegant design fits nicely on a narrow lot and provides a lot of flexibility in the layout. Families will enjoy the spaciousness and option for a fifth bedroom. Later on, the four private suites will be much appreciated by visitors (or grown children). An elevator option makes it easier to get around, especially for an elderly relative. Private Guest Suite and Outdoor Living

Wrapping around a side courtyard, this striking home design gives owners private outdoor living on a narrow lot. A detached guest suite welcomes visitors. In the main gathering spaces, the kitchen boasts two islands and overlooks the great room, which opens out to the loggia for seamless indoor-outdoor connections. Upscale Details for Downsizing Buyers

Full of thoughtful amenities, this one-story home fits nicely on a slim lot. The kitchen takes center stage, with a large island and a separate wine cooler area that makes it easy to grab a special bottle while entertaining family and friends. Ceiling treatments throughout the home draw the eye up. In the master suite, two spacious walk-in closets give plenty of wardrobe room to both partners, while the spa-like bathroom shows off a walk-in shower and separate tub. Impressive Suites

This home may fit a narrow lot, but every room inside boasts lots of space and luxurious amenities. Start with the great room: upon entering from the two-story foyer, you’re greeted with a lovely view out two sets of double doors to the rear veranda. Two islands provide space in the kitchen for meal prep and easy socializing at the snack bar. An elevator makes going up to the second floor easy. Up here, you’ll find three large bedrooms, including the deluxe master suite with its two-sided fireplace that warms the bedroom and luxurious bath.
